Hello all. I have a question about the flash capability of the EOS M10. It has no built in flash shoe but it claims to have a flash sync port. Can anyone tell me what this means? Can a cable be connected to this port to attach an off body flash shoe? I am aware it already has a small pop up flash. I was wondering if there was any way to attach an external flash. I am also not sure if it has wireless flash capabilities. Thanks for any help or info.

The M10 Camera User Guide makes no mention of a "flash sync port".
It does have HDMI and USB Interfaces, but neither one is usable as a flash sync port.

There is no flash sync port available on the EOS M10. The camera does not have native wireless flash function settings.
